Progressive’s glass coverage for RVs is typically part of their comprehensive insurance policy. It’s designed to cover damage to the glass components of your recreational vehicle, including the windshield, side windows, skylights, and even decorative glass elements. Unlike basic liability coverage, which is mandatory in most states, comprehensive coverage (and thus glass coverage) is optional but highly recommended.
Progressive’s glass coverage generally includes: - Windshield Repair and Replacement: This is the most common claim. Whether it’s a small chip from a stray rock or a large crack from hailstorm debris, Progressive covers the cost of repair or full replacement. - Side and Rear Windows: Damage to any window on the RV is included. - Vent Windows and Skylights: These are often overlooked but are critical for ventilation and light. - Seal and Molding Replacement: When glass is replaced, the surrounding seals and moldings are often replaced too to prevent leaks. - O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) Parts: Depending on your policy and the age of your RV, Progressive may offer OEM glass, which is identical to what was originally installed. - Mobile Repair Services: In many cases, Progressive can send a technician to your location to repair or replace the glass, minimizing downtime.
It’s important to note that glass coverage usually doesn’t include: - Damage caused intentionally or due to negligence (like failing to secure the RV in a storm). - Wear and tear over time. - Glass damage covered under a manufacturer’s warranty. - Deductibles may apply unless you have full glass coverage (which waives the deductible for glass repairs).

Modern RVs are equipped with adv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S) such as lane departure warnings and collision avoidance. Many of these systems rely on cameras and sensors embedded in the windshield. Replacing such windshields requires calibration, which can be technically complex and costly. Progressive’s coverage often includes the recalibration of these systems, ensuring that safety features function correctly after glass replacement. This is vital in an age where technology is integral to vehicle safety.

Progressive offers policies with varying deductibles. Opting for a lower deductible might mean a slightly higher premium, but it can save you money out-of-pocket when you need a repair. Some policies even include zero-deductible glass coverage, which is ideal for those who want maximum protection.
In the event of damage, document it with photos and notes on the date and circumstances. Progressive’s claims process is streamlined through their app and website, allowing you to file a claim quickly. Their 24/7 claims service is especially useful for travelers in different time zones.
While coverage is there for when things go wrong, prevention is key. Park under cover during hailstorms, avoid tailgating trucks carrying debris, and regularly inspect seals around windows to prevent leaks.
Policies can vary by state and by the specific RV type (e.g., motorhome vs. travel trailer). Review your policy documents or speak with a Progressive representative to confirm what’s covered. For example, some policies might have limitations on custom or aftermarket glass.
